Founded in 1963, Leslie's is the largest and most trusted direct-to-consumer brand in the U.S. pool and spa care industry. We serve the aftermarket needs of residential and professional consumers with an extensive and largely exclusive assortment of essential pool and spa care products. We operate an integrated ecosystem of 900+ retail locations, backyard service and repair, a robust digital platform, and manufacturing and distribution divisions across 35+ states—enabling consumers to engage with Leslie’s whenever, wherever, and however they prefer to shop. Job Overview

As the Senior Vice President, Chief Marketing Officer (SVP, CMO), you will play a critical role in shaping and executing Leslie’s enterprise growth strategy. Reporting directly to the Chief Executive Officer (CEO), you will lead the vision, strategy, and execution of all marketing and ecommerce initiatives to drive brand strength, customer engagement, revenue growth, and profitability.

In this highly visible leadership role, you will oversee Marketing, Ecommerce, and Marketplace functions, positioning Leslie’s as a market leader while delivering a best-in-class digital and omnichannel customer experience. With a strong data-driven and innovative mindset, you will build and scale a world-class marketing and digital organization within a fast-paced, publicly traded environment. You will also serve as a key enterprise leader, fostering a collaborative, high-performance culture aligned with Leslie’s mission and values.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and execute a comprehensive marketing and ecommerce strategy aligned with enterprise objectives and long-term growth initiatives.
  • Lead brand strategy, positioning, messaging, and communications to strengthen brand awareness, differentiation, and reputation.
  • Drive customer acquisition, retention, and engagement strategies across digital, social, traditional, and direct marketing channels.
  • Design and implement customer loyalty and membership programs, including Pool Perks, to increase engagement and customer lifetime value.
  • Own and optimize the ecommerce P&L, maximizing the contribution and profitability of digital channels.
  • Define and lead the digital and ecommerce roadmap, continuously prioritizing initiatives that deliver a seamless, frictionless customer experience.
  • Oversee marketing and ecommerce analytics, leveraging Snowflake and Power BI to accelerate insight delivery and data-driven decision-making.
  • Analyze performance data to identify trends, opportunities, and areas for continuous improvement.
  • Establish and report on KPIs and performance metrics across marketing and ecommerce functions.
  • Build, mentor, and lead a high-performing, innovative marketing and ecommerce organization, fostering creativity, accountability, and collaboration.
  • Partner closely with merchandising, stores, and technology teams to ensure alignment with product launches, sales strategies, and omnichannel customer experiences.
  • Present marketing and ecommerce strategies, performance updates, and growth initiatives to the Board of Directors, executive leadership team, and key stakeholders.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Marketing, Business, or a related field required; MBA or advanced degree preferred.
  • 10–15+ years of progressive marketing leadership experience, with at least 5 years in a senior executive role (VP, SVP, CMO, CDO), ideally within a public company or high-growth organization.
  • Proven track record of building and leading high-performing marketing and digital teams.
  • Deep expertise in digital marketing, ecommerce, brand management, customer engagement, and analytics within a competitive marketplace.
  • Strong executive presence with exceptional communication, presentation, and influencing skills, including experience engaging Boards and investors.
  • Highly data-driven mindset, with demonstrated success using metrics and KPIs to drive strategy and performance.
  • Ability to translate complex business objectives into innovative, scalable marketing strategies and campaigns.
  • Working knowledge of marketing, advertising, and customer data compliance regulations in a public company environment.
  • Strong alignment with Leslie’s culture, values, and mission.
